The short answer

No human trial has ever tested sea buckthorn for hair growth. Everything claimed for it rests on tradition and on nutrients that exist in the oil and also matter in follicle biology. That makes “supports a healthy scalp” defensible and “regrows hair” invented. If growth is the goal, proven options exist, and this oil can only play support.

The argument for, stated fairly

Hair follicles are skin, and sea buckthorn oil has real evidence for skin hydration and elasticity. It carries vitamin E, carotenoids, and fatty acids that appear in legitimate hair-biology research. A well-moisturized, uninflamed scalp is a better environment for hair than a dry, flaky one.

Every word of that is true. None of it demonstrates regrowth. Skin evidence does not transfer automatically to follicles, and nutrient presence in a bottle says nothing about reaching a follicle at a useful dose.

The argument against, stated plainly

  • No human hair trials. Zero.
  • The animal and cell studies behind online claims used doses and routes that do not translate to a scalp massage.
  • Hair loss has real causes (hormones, genetics, thyroid, iron, stress) that an oil cannot touch.

The sane way to use it

What actually regrows hair

Minoxidil and finasteride have decades of trial data. Sudden shedding, patchy loss, or loss with fatigue or weight change deserves a doctor and basic blood work first, because fixable causes hide there. Sea buckthorn can share a shelf with those answers. It cannot replace them.

The nutrient logic, itemized

The honest case starts with real contents. The oil carries vitamin E, carotenoids, and a fatty acid spread that includes omega-7 in the berry oil and omega-3 with omega-6 in the seed oil. Every one of those appears in legitimate skin and follicle biology. The follicle is a skin structure, so the reasoning goes, feeding the skin feeds the hair. The reasoning is coherent. It is also where the evidence stops. The berry oil’s omega-7 gets the marketing, but marketing is not an endpoint.

Why presence is not a dose

A nutrient in a bottle and a nutrient reaching a follicle at a useful concentration are different events separated by absorption, transport, and dilution. Topical oil sits mostly on the surface it is spread on, which is the scalp’s outer layers, not the follicle base where hair is made. Oral oil feeds the whole body a few grams at a time, and no measured route has ever been tied to a hair outcome in a human trial.

Why animal and cell studies do not settle it

The studies behind online growth claims used cell cultures and lab animals, at doses and by routes that do not resemble a scalp massage. Cells in a dish meet the extract directly. Mice receive scaled doses no sensible human routine matches. That is how preliminary science works, and it is why our evidence file lists no human hair entry at all. The stress and shedding chapter

One real cause deserves its own paragraph: a shock to the system can push hair into a shedding phase weeks later, after illness, surgery, major stress, or rapid weight change. That pattern usually reverses on its own over months, and an oil neither causes nor cures it. What matters is recognizing it, because shedding that arrives with fatigue, weight change, or feeling cold points at thyroid or iron, and that is blood-work territory.

The proven options, one level deeper

Minoxidil and finasteride remain the two treatments with decades of human trial data for pattern loss. Both take months to show results, both work better at keeping hair than regrowing it, and both carry suitability questions that make them doctor conversations rather than recommendations from us. The consistent finding across that literature is that earlier starts keep more hair, which is why waiting a year on oils has a real cost.

The honest bottom line

Sea buckthorn is a conditioning oil with a plausible nutrient story and no human hair trial. Used as grooming, it earns its place. Sold as a growth treatment, it fails a test it never took. The distinction is this whole page in two sentences.

Frequently asked questions

Can sea buckthorn regrow hair?

There is no human evidence that sea buckthorn regrows hair. No clinical trial has tested it for hair count, thickness, or shedding. Its nutrients (omega fatty acids, vitamin E, carotenoids) play roles in skin and follicle biology, which is suggestive but not proof. For actual regrowth, minoxidil and finasteride have the trial data.

How long should I try sea buckthorn before judging hair results?

For conditioning, judge after four to six weeks of the pre-wash ritual. For growth, there is no trial-defined timeline because there are no trials. If shedding is your concern, do not spend months waiting on an oil: sudden loss, patches, or loss with fatigue or weight change deserves a doctor and basic blood work first.
